[問題] WPF 使用LineSegment繪圖的問題

看板C_Sharp (C#)作者 (Reinace)時間7年前 (2018/03/09 00:02), 編輯推噓0(001)
留言1則, 1人參與, 7年前最新討論串1/1
想請問一下,最近使用 WPF 的 LineSegment 來繪圖 會遇到假如線條夾角角度很小的時候,WPF會自動幫我延伸一段出去 雖然資料裡面的點座標沒錯,可是視覺上看起來就是位置整個都偏了 https://i.imgur.com/KFeVJJn.png
https://i.imgur.com/sy289HX.png
像以上2張圖,第一條線段的EndPoint都是同一個點 可是看起來第2張圖轉角就是尖出去,線寬越粗尖出去就越嚴重 想請問有辦法解決嗎? 我的畫法是使用 Path.Data = PathGeometry PathGeometry 的 Figure 在包 PathFigure PathFigure在包 2段的 LineSegment 麻煩大家了 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 122.121.190.40 ※ 文章網址: https://www.ptt.cc/bbs/C_Sharp/M.1520524961.A.351.html

03/09 10:02, 7年前 , 1F
我找到了,原來設定的屬性是放在pen不是在segment裡..
03/09 10:02, 1F
文章代碼(AID): #1QeLwXDH (C_Sharp)
文章代碼(AID): #1QeLwXDH (C_Sharp)